These are the positive Stories of the past 10 Days in BiH

Published: October 9, 2023
Share
SHARE

In the age of mass media and many negative news that daily showers the whole world, and therefore Bosnia and Herzegovina(BiH), positive stories have a very hard time breaking out and very often do not find their way to a large number of people.

Here is a short section that reminds of the positive stories that happened in the past period and thus additionally encourage all those who record successes, do humanitarian deeds, or write positive stories in some other way throughout the entire BiH.

Ten days ago, a story about the organization “Respekt” was published, which, thanks to its inclusive approach, provides free access to sports for marginalized children and youth with developmental disabilities. Because of their work, they have won three UEFA awards.

In the field of medicine, a positive story comes from the “Prim.Dr. Abdulah Nakas” General Hospital. There were special emotions at the end of this week’s education, which was arranged for the staff of the Department of Physical Medicine and Rehabilitation, and which was held in this health facility by representatives of the company ReWalk Robotics with its European headquarters in Berlin and OrtoSar from Sarajevo.

Television producer Almin Karamehmedovic, who is originally from Sarajevo, showed that there are very beautiful stories in showbiz. He won the 15th Emmy Award in America.

He is the producer of ABC News’ “World News Tonight” and won his 15th Grammy Award for Outstanding Live News.

At the end of September, Sarajevo Mayor Benjamina Karicpresented certificates of thanks to doctors Ettore Pedretti, Senka Dinarevic Mesihovic and Aida Sejdic Melezovic who, since 2002, have moved to Italy and operated 72 children all over BiHfree of charge.

And finally, a story from Gorazde. Voluntary work actions today are definitely one of the social phenomena of the past, but it is also a fact that in some places there are still young people who grow up with the feeling that by participating in the action they gave something useful to society.

A team of young people gathered around Amel Begovic from Bogusici near Gorazde has been participating in various actions for years, which ultimately produce great results in the place where they live.

And finally, the best BiH swimmer Lana Pudar made it to another World Cup final in Berlin. Lana fought for a new medal yesterday afternoon, Klix.ba reports.
